About

Greenwich Park ward encompasses the historic park itself along with the surrounding residential streets to the north and west. The area is defined by its steep topography, with streets like Croom's Hill and Point Hill offering expansive views over the Thames and central London. The architecture is a mix of Georgian and Victorian terraces, alongside more modern developments, housing a population that includes long-term residents and professionals.

The ward's central feature is the UNESCO World Heritage Site of the Old Royal Naval College and the National Maritime Museum, situated at the park's northern edge. The park provides extensive green space with the Royal Observatory, the Prime Meridian line, and deer enclosures. Local activity focuses on the independent shops and cafes along Greenwich Church Street and the weekly market near the Cutty Sark.

Area overview

On average Greenwich Park has moderate deprivation and high crime levels, with around 151 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. Approximately 27.0%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income per household in Greenwich Park is £84,755 per year. There are 3 schools in Greenwich Park: 2 primary (0 Outstanding and 2 Good) and 1 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good). On average most houses in area has good public transport connectivity. Greenwich Park is home to around 10,554 people, with a population density of about 5,198.4 per km2.

Property prices in Greenwich Park

Based on 115 recent sales, the median property price is £550,000 in Greenwich Park area, with individual transactions ranging from £147,004 up to £3,150,000.
